A heartfelt, uplifting play about three women whose lives intertwine across space and time as they grapple to overcome gender roles, societal expectations, and uncertainty in their pursuit of the stars.
Inspired by the legacy of astronomer Annie Jump Cannon, this poetic, sincere, and feminist play urges us to believe in ourselves, harness the infinite possibilities that exist within us, and reach for the stars.
